Research Behind Sex Drive and Exercise
The research on sexual health and exercise is generally encouraging.
One such study discovered that people who exercised at least 90 minutes per week were 20% less likely to develop ED.
Going out and running on a regular basis will not have a negative impact on your testosterone levels. Rather, it has the opposite effect. A study found that weekly exercises lasting 160 minutes help reduce erectile dysfunction in men with ED.
Excessive exercise, on the other hand, is not ideal. A study of endurance runners discovered that they had lower testosterone levels due to overtraining.
Whether you’re eating or exercising, it’s critical to practice moderation. Nonetheless, some exercises are more beneficial to sexual health than others. Here we are introducing you to 9 exercises that can boost your libido.
Plié squat

A Plié Squat is an exercise that strengthens the legs, glutes, and calves while also increasing the hip range of motion. Plié Squats are derived from the ballet position Plié, which maintains a straight back while bending the knees.
When learning how to perform the Plié Squat, also known as a sumo squat. There are a few barre movements that will target the pelvic floor if you focus on engaging the muscles while performing them. You’ll enjoy stronger, more intense sex while also strengthening your entire body.
Stand with your feet slightly wider than shoulder-width apart and your toes bent at a 45-degree angle. Lower your torso while keeping your back straight and abs tight. Squeeze your glutes and rise to your feet.
Double leg raise

This exercise improves the strength of your lower abdominal muscles, pelvic floor, and lower back.” Lay on your back to perform the move. For added support, place your thumbs under your tailbone.
Raise your legs, flexing your feet as if about to kick your heels into the ceiling. Engage your core as you lower your legs slowly to the floor. Only lower until you feel your abs engage, but don’t let your lower back lift off the floor.
Hip opening stretch

This hip opening stretch will increase flexibility and make it easier to get down without cramping up. Begin on all fours, then bring your big toes together and gradually begin to walk your knees apart while lowering your chest toward the floor.
Take your time breathing into those areas of tension and tightness. You’ll sink a little deeper with each exhalation—the more you stretch, the easier it gets. Rep two to three times more.
Clam hip raises

Maybe you’ve never heard of this leg and hip strengthening exercise, but it’s one you should add to your workout routine. This exercise, named after the way your legs and hips resemble a clamshell when performing it, will strengthen your hips and thighs while also stabilizing your pelvic muscles and toning your glutes.
Begin on your side on the floor. Prop yourself up on your forearm, keeping your legs together and your knees bent. Lift your hips off the floor and keep your heels connected as you open your top knee toward the ceiling. Reduce your speed gradually. Repeat on the other side after five reps.
Bear crawls

Bear crawls are an essential component of a functional fitness program that emphasizes the use of ground movement to strengthen your entire body. This exercise engages nearly every muscle joint in the human upper body, making it an ideal compound exercise. Moving forward and back while hovering your knees improves strength, endurance, and stamina.
Tuck your toes and press your hands into the floor before lifting your knees to hover two inches off the ground. Move one arm and the opposite leg forward, then switch sides. On alternate sides, you’ll rock back and forth.
Knee tucks

Knee tucks are an excellent exercise for strengthening your core and targeting your abs. Aside from the obvious aesthetic benefits, having a strong core protects your back from injury and can greatly improve your posture. This exercise will help to strengthen the lower back while also increasing arousal.
Lay on your back with your legs bent and your feet firmly on the floor; then lift your feet off the floor and hug your knees in toward your chest, lifting the hips as you contract your core.
Plank pose

Holding a plank pose is one of the most effective exercises for increasing endurance and stamina for better sex.
The plank works the entire body in a single static position. Hold this asana for 30 seconds several times a day to strengthen your abs, hands, wrists, arms, shoulders, back, core, glutes, and legs.
Begin by getting down on your hands and knees on the ground. Plant your forearms parallel to the floor, then tuck your toes and straighten your legs, adjusting your body as needed to achieve a straight line from your head to your heels.
Lunge

Lunges are a powerful exercise that shapes and strengthens nearly every muscle in the lower body. It will also improve your flexibility, making it easier to move through different positions with your partner.
Bend your knees and lower your body until your back knee is just a few inches off the ground. The front thigh is parallel to the ground at the bottom of the movement, the back knee is pointing toward the floor, and your weight is evenly distributed between both legs. Return to the starting position, keeping your weight on the front foot’s heel.
Upright pelvic tucks

Many people make the common error of popping their booty back before tucking, which is ineffective. Tuck your pelvic floor muscles in and then relax back to neutral.
Begin on your knees, keeping your thighs and spine aligned. Scoop your hips back, tilting your pelvis to activate your lower abdominal muscles. Lower yourself until you reach your heels, then slowly straighten up. Practicing your tuck in the mirror will help you improve your form.

Other Tips to Boost Sex Drive
There are some other tips that can boost your sex drive these are;
Limit your alcohol consumption. Everyone reacts differently to alcohol, but in general, drinking too much before sex can dull your sensations and make it difficult to stay aroused.
Foreplay is essential. Slowly stoke the flames with a bit of foreplay before exploding into the main event.
Lubrication. Lube can make sex more enjoyable by reducing friction. Certain lubes, such as desensitizers, can also extend the duration of your romp.
Be present. Don’t rush through your sex time. Instead, live in the present moment, savoring every moment of pleasure.
Explore more than just the genitals. You’ll orgasm quickly if you concentrate on the genitals. Instead, go slowly and thoroughly to arouse desire.
Switch between active and passive roles. Switching roles allows your arousal to come in and out in waves, making sex last longer.
Grabbing at the base of your penis may help prevent premature ejaculation if you have one. Squeezing at the base will result in a loss of erection and prevent you from climaxing.
A numbing cream applied to the tip can also help prevent premature ejaculation. A numbing cream can help you last longer by reducing sensations in the penis.
Herbs to Boost Your Libido
Do you want to improve your stamina naturally? Here we are introducing you to herbs that can naturally boost your libido.
Herbs for unisex
Damiana. This subtropical plant is thought to boost sexual desire and endurance.
Guarana. This Brazilian plant has a high caffeine content and is thought to increase energy and libido.
Maca. This highly nutritious Peruvian plant is thought to increase sex drive.
Herbs for Male
Ginseng. This slow-growing short plant is thought to alleviate erectile dysfunction symptoms.
Catuaba. This small tree from Brazil is thought to be an aphrodisiac. It may also aid in the treatment of erectile dysfunction.
Lycium. This Chinese fruit plant, also known as goji berry, has qualities to boost testosterone levels and treat erectile dysfunction.
Herbs for Female
Ginkgo biloba. This Chinese plant extract may boost your sex drive as well as your brain power and energy.
Ashwagandha. This evergreen shrub is thought to boost libido and stamina by balancing sex hormones.
